vue一般配合什么框架使用
-
vue一般配合以下几个框架使用:
-
Vuex:Vuex是Vue.js的官方状态管理库,用于集中管理应用程序的所有组件的状态。它能够使得应用程序的状态变得可预测且易于维护。Vuex可以与Vue的响应式系统无缝集成,使得数据的变化可以被组件所感知和响应。通过使用Vuex,开发者可以更加有效地组织和管理应用程序的状态,并且更好地处理复杂的状态逻辑。
-
Vue Router:Vue Router是Vue.js官方的路由管理器。它可以帮助开发者构建单页面应用程序(SPA)并实现页面之间的导航和跳转。Vue Router基于Vue的组件化开发思想,使得路由的配置和管理非常灵活和易于使用。通过使用Vue Router,开发者可以轻松地实现路由的懒加载、动态路由、嵌套路由等功能,并且可以方便地管理页面之间的过渡效果。
-
Element UI:Element UI是一套基于Vue.js的桌面端组件库,它提供了丰富的UI组件和交互指令,能够帮助开发者快速构建美观、易用的用户界面。Element UI的设计风格和规范符合现代化的Web界面设计趋势,而且它使用起来非常简单和方便。通过使用Element UI,开发者可以节省大量的开发时间和精力,提升开发效率。
除了上述框架外,Vue.js还可以与其他第三方库和工具进行配合使用,例如:
-
Axios:Axios是一个基于Promise的HTTP客户端,它可以在浏览器和Node.js中发送HTTP请求。Vue.js可以利用Axios来进行数据的获取和交互,例如向后端API发送请求和接收响应。
-
Vuetify:Vuetify是一个基于Vue.js的Material Design组件库,它提供了一套丰富的Material Design风格的UI组件,能够快速构建现代化的Web应用程序。
总之,根据具体的项目需求,可以选择使用合适的框架或库来配合Vue.js进行开发,以提高开发效率和用户体验。
2年前 -
-
Vue.js 是一种用于构建用户界面的渐进式JavaScript框架,它通常可以与其他一些框架或库一起使用来增强其功能。以下是Vue.js常配合的几个主流框架:
-
Vuex:Vuex 是一个为 Vue.js 应用程序开发的状态管理模式。Vue.js 的核心是响应式的数据绑定和组件系统,但是当应用程序变得复杂时,管理组件之间共享的状态就变得困难,这时就可以使用 Vuex。Vuex 提供了一个集中式存储管理你的应用的所有组件的状态,并以相应的规则保证状态的改变只能通过特定的方式进行。
-
Vue Router:Vue Router 是 Vue.js 官方的路由管理器。它和 Vue.js 的深度结合让构建单页应用变得非常简单。Vue Router 可以配置多个路由,并在应用中实现页面跳转、路由传参、路由拦截等功能。通过使用 Vue Router,我们可以在 Vue.js 中实现页面的无刷新切换、动态加载路由、导航守卫等功能。
-
Axios:Axios 是一个基于 Promise 的 HTTP 请求库,可以用于在 Vue.js 应用中发送异步的网络请求。它可以用于发送 GET、POST、PUT、DELETE 等不同类型的请求,并提供了多种方式来配置请求参数、设置请求头、处理返回数据等。由于 Axios 非常流行且易于使用,因此在 Vue.js 中使用 Axios 进行网络请求是常见的做法。
-
Element UI:Element UI 是一个基于 Vue.js 的桌面端组件库。它提供了一套丰富的交互式组件和样式,非常适合用于构建后台管理系统、数据展示页面等。Element UI 的组件设计简洁、易用,而且有很好的文档和社区支持,因此在 Vue.js 应用中使用 Element UI 是常见的选择。
-
Vuetify:Vuetify 是一个基于 Vue.js 的响应式框架,用于构建现代化的Web应用程序。它提供了一套美观、易用的UI组件和配套的设计规范,可以快速地构建出符合 Material Design 标准的Web界面。Vuetify 能够帮助开发人员节省大量的时间和精力,是一个很受欢迎的 Vue.js 框架。
除了以上提到的框架,Vue.js 还可以与其他诸如Mint UI、Ant Design Vue、Quasar等框架或库一起使用,根据具体需求选择合适的框架进行配合使用,以满足项目的要求。
2年前 -
-
Vue.js 是一个轻量级的、用于构建用户界面的 JavaScript 框架,它通常与其他前端框架或工具库一起使用来构建复杂的应用程序。
以下是常见的与 Vue.js 配合使用的框架:
-
Vue Router:Vue Router 是 Vue.js 的官方路由管理器。它允许你通过定义路由和视图来构建单页面应用。Vue Router 提供了路由导航、异步组件加载、路由参数传递等功能,以帮助你构建高效的路由之间导航。
-
Vuex:Vuex 是 Vue.js 的官方状态管理库。它用于管理应用程序的状态。Vuex 使用集中式存储管理并响应式地更新状态,使得多个组件可以共享和修改同一份数据。通过使用 Vuex,你可以更好地组织和管理复杂的应用程序状态,并实现数据的统一管理。
-
Axios:Axios 是一个用于发送 HTTP 请求的库,它可以与 Vue.js 无缝集成。Axios 支持 Promise API,可以用来处理异步请求和响应。通过使用 Axios,你可以方便地与后端服务器进行通信,获取或发送数据。
-
Element UI / Vue Material / Vuetify:这些是一些常用的 UI 组件库,它们提供了丰富的可重用组件,用于构建漂亮、响应式的用户界面。这些组件库与 Vue.js 完美结合,并且在开发过程中可以让你更快地构建出具有一致风格和良好体验的界面。
-
Nuxt.js:Nuxt.js 是一个基于 Vue.js 的通用应用框架,它简化了 Vue.js 应用的开发和部署。Nuxt.js 提供了预渲染、代码分割、服务器端渲染等功能,以提高应用程序的性能和 SEO。
除了以上框架,还有许多其他的 Vue.js 相关的框架和工具,如Vue-cli、Vuetify、Quasar、VueFire 等等,你可以根据项目需求选择合适的框架来配合使用。
2年前 -